An essential collection, "Phenomenology and Sociology: Selected Readings" is edited by Thomas Luckmann, a prominent figure in the field of social phenomenology. This paperback volume, published by Penguin Books in Harmondsworth in 1978, explores the intricate relationship between sociology and phenomenology.The book delves into how phenomenology, with its radical new perspective, re-establishes human experience at the core of understanding the world, offering a fresh analytical lens for the social sciences. The included readings from various viewpoints aim to illuminate the methods, domains, and goals of both disciplines?sociology and phenomenology?while also clarifying common confusions surrounding phenomenological thought.This is not a first edition.
